Vineyards
Taste is key, which is why every wine has been tasted by their expert team. Recommendations are carefully thought through and taken incredibly seriously at Vineyards. So much so, a second tasting for each wine is “blind” to ensure that no bias can influence the sampling of each sip. Expect to leave with a “clink” in each step and the confidence in exactly what you are drinking with a little taste of it’s story.
Approachable and knowledgeable, the team often invite visitors for group tastings and like a spot of friendly competition on their social media pages. Believing in the power of a personal experience, the shop is informal and relaxed. Enjoy a place to browse with a touch of expert advice should you need it.
It is our very personal approach to selling wine that makes being an indie special. Wine is not just a drink: it’s a talking point, it’s a social tool, it’s a thank you, a sign of gratitude, an accompaniment to a meal with others.

Sherborne
The heart of Sherborne lies in the interesting character in each of it's buildings and the individual characters inside every independent shop and cafe. With the oldest building, The Abbey, dating back as far as AD705, English writers throughout the ages have praised the town's inescapable beauty. Following the footsteps of poets and novelists such as Thomas Hardy and John le Carré, you can still enjoy and discover pockets of architectural beauty from centuries past with a walk through those quaint and rambling streets.
Boasting traditional charm and a friendly village atmosphere, the local independents are a winner when it comes to getting a feel for the Sherborne community.
